It also never ceases to amaze me that people will compromise a widely used library / service and then ship a highly specific Bitcoin malware instead of a more general infostealer or something like that. If you have that kind of access, why burn it on something dumb? I mean, I guess I'm happy they did, but still. Also, Permission Policy works - on the site I was doing incident response for, the malware was actually blocked by the Permission Policy disabling clipboard access requests.
